Output 84d32ce5394f9518ef6584a27477178280c7c370a3825972bf7be12335f819fb:0

value
2715404966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b277b2e3a47b9b4e9ede6f30a7780230ddbd91d OP_EQUALVERIFY OP_CHECKSIG
address
16PnAX3me9uTsMLcSpRsr3FeUNpnqVoFT9
transaction
84d32ce5394f9518ef6584a27477178280c7c370a3825972bf7be12335f819fb
spent
true